Output 685077e88628eb273331abf8a55d7ce14a996f9f410cee9627f1bd834335dca9:0

value
533037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c739f29cc6ddab134c260c6360861f9633ceaaf OP_EQUAL
address
3QhriRXoEqE8hqbw36kA1gevTMZ8iLxGVP
transaction
685077e88628eb273331abf8a55d7ce14a996f9f410cee9627f1bd834335dca9
confirmations
289573
spent
true